As a gift buyer for my grandkids' fish tank, I was MOST LIKELY looking for something reliable to ease my worries when I'm away. The problem was my forgetfulness with feeding times, but this device offered a solution with its scheduling feature. However, after using it for a couple of weeks, I've found it's not perfect—it works well when it functions, but the occasional malfunctions mean I still have to check on it. The takeaway is that it's a decent helper, but not a complete replacement for manual care. I'd recommend it with caution for those who can monitor it closely.
- Pros: The programmable timer is super handy, allowing me to set up to four meals a day, which keeps my fish on a consistent schedule without me having to remember. I like that it runs on batteries, so there's no messy wiring to deal with, and the portion size can be adjusted easily to prevent overfeeding—a big plus for maintaining their health.
- Cons: It's not without flaws; the build feels a bit flimsy, and I've had some issues with it jamming occasionally, leading to missed meals. The battery life isn't great, requiring frequent changes, and it can be tricky to program for someone not used to gadgets.
